Those look like standard sending units, which have white plastic tops. You may want to measure the length, and resistance at empty position, before getting too excited. Also, the EPC has errors where it shows the -03-04 yellow-top sending unit in diesel 90L tanks, which is not how the cars were delivered from the factory.2 90 Liter fuel sending units.
